Shaena Lambert’s novel Radiance was chosen as a ‘best book of the year’ by both the Globe and Mail and Quill and Quire and was a finalist for the Rogers Writers Trust Award and the Ethel Wilson Award. Her collection The Falling Woman was published to critical acclaim in Canada, the UK and Germany, and was a finalist for the Danuta Gleed Award. Her stories have appeared recently in Zoetrope: All Story, The Vancouver Review, and Best Canadian Stories 2010, and are forthcoming in Ploughshares, guest-selected by Colm Toibin, and Best Canadian Stories 2011. She lives in Vancouver, where she teaches at The Writers’ Studio at Simon Fraser University.
